City Destinations Alliance (CityDNA) is seeking an Interim Head of Relationship Marketing and Commercial Development (fixed-term, minimum 12 months) to ensure continuity and momentum during a key transition period. This is a senior, hands-on leadership role at the centre of a leading European network of city destination organisations and meetings industry professionals.

You will lead across two equally important mandates:

Member community leadership (≈120 DMOs): strengthen relationships, drive retention and engagement, and support alliance growth.
Commercial & income generation: protect and grow revenue through membership growth and commercial partner development (pipeline, proposals, renewals, partner servicing).

What you’ll do

Translate strategy into clear action plans, high-quality briefs, and structured follow-through across priorities.
Prepare and run governance cycles (Board / Executive Committee / General Assembly) with strong documentation and decision tracking.
Manage the Head Office team: prioritise, allocate work, coach, remove blockers, and ensure consistent quality delivery.
Oversee knowledge-sharing content aligned with CityDNA strategy (insights, toolkits, synthesis notes, learning moments).
Manage relationships with commercial partners and contribute to partnership growth and renewals.
Provide senior oversight for EU collaboration where relevant, including DEPLOYTOUR (LEAR / coordinator responsibilities) and BEFuture: representation, meeting follow-up, coordination of inputs and deliverables (with project support).
Provide senior guidance to ensure communications and marketing are aligned with strategy and stakeholder needs (delivery remains with the communications function).

What we’re looking for

A senior profile with strong governance discipline, excellent judgement, and proven ability to operate confidently with senior stakeholders while staying close to execution. You bring:

Proven experience in alliances/networks/associations or complex stakeholder ecosystems
Track record in commercial development (membership and/or partnerships/sponsorship)
Strength in managing large communities and relationships at scale
Strong writing/synthesis, structured execution, and team leadership
EU project/consortia experience is a plus

Location: Europe (hybrid), with extensive travel for key meetings and industry events, plus part of the time at CityDNA Head Office in Dijon (France).
